Output 6e7291535ef71dd6fc0ecd936f96848d8b7072af382d7a87ed97f0341319751a:1

value
2997965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e47f6596b87063a52d5b6eb51817e9f4f4e7751 OP_EQUAL
address
MDaULMNcbwcwhphgrVvNfnMeDpTrdNcSKH
transaction
6e7291535ef71dd6fc0ecd936f96848d8b7072af382d7a87ed97f0341319751a
spent
true